My "Loving Lauren" by Jill Sanders Review
Lauren had been raised to not be afraid of anything, and she lived by that code, that is until her dad died and left everything in her hands. Now she’s not only in charge of her two younger sisters, but she’s running a full-blown Texas ranch. Caring for a thousand‑acre ranch has its ups and downs, physically, mentally, and financially. All she is looking for is a little break. What she doesn't have time for is someone who will only complicate her life further. Chase is back in his hometown. Helping his dad with his veterinary practice is high on his list. So is being with the lovely Lauren West. Years ago, he found a unique way to bind them together. Now all he has to do is prove to her that he’s the right man to spend the rest of her life with.
My Review:In this first book of the West Series we meet Lauren West. Lauren is the responsible, level-headed, older sister of Alexis and Hailey. She’s also in charge of running her family’s ranch after the untimely death of her father. Running a ranch is hard enough, but add in the fact that Lauren’s father was in debt to his two best friends doesn’t make things any easier for our young heroine. In steps Lauren’s childhood friend Chase Graham. Chase has had a thing for Lauren for as long as he can remember, and seeing her struggle just kills him. So he makes her a business proposition…he’ll give her the money she needs to save her ranch if she marries him. In an act of desperation, Lauren accepts and the two marry in a super-secret ceremony that no one ever knows about. Lauren is able to save her ranch, and Chase has tied himself to the woman he loves just in time for him to leave for college. Fast forward seven years later, Chase moves back home with the intentions of winning Lauren over and making their marriage real instead of just a business deal. But Lauren isn’t having any part of it. She doesn’t want to be considered anyone’s charity case and has worked hard over the past seven years to pay Chase back so they can get divorced. But with Chase around all the time, Lauren soon realizes her true feelings for him and finds herself wanting this marriage to be the real deal.
I really enjoyed this book! I loved the characters, sharp dialogue, and the story very much. Lauren is such a hard-working, loving person, but I did find myself mentally bashing her for being so darn stubborn when it came to Chase. She just wouldn’t let the guy catch a break :) Chase is such a sweet-heart, and so darn sexy. I just loved him!
The story that unfolds for Lauren and Chase is truly wonderful and completely heartfelt, with some unexpected added suspense/action thrown in. Although I enjoyed that added bit of suspense/action, I really don’t think the novel needed it. It was a solid read without that, but of course that’s just my personal reader opinion. I would definitely recommend this book if you enjoy contemporary romances.
